The announcement, while not unexpected, throws into question the future of the 24-year-old space station, with experts saying it would be extremely difficult-perhaps a “nightmare,” by one reckoning-to keep it running without the Russians. NASA and its partners had hoped to continue operating it until 2030. 


Leave a Reply

Your email address will not be published.

Generated by Feedzy